Как перевести координаты google в gps

Геоинформационные системы (ГИС) и Дистанционное зондирование Земли

Проблема возникла в смешении систем исчисления. Угловые величины исторически (со времен древнего Вавилона) измеряли в шестидесятиричной системе. Так же как время в часах. Секундная стрелка прошла 60 делений и переводим разряд (минуты) на одно деление. 60 минут формируют 1 час (1 градус). (В десятичной системе это будут по аналогии — единицы, десятки, сотни).

В добавок, сами градусы считают уже в десятичной системе — 69° в шестидесятиричной системе быть не может, должен был произойти переход на еще более высокий разряд. Но, видимо, договорились в 60-ричной считать только дробную часть.

Число 69°03,489″ можно записать как 69.05815°и 69°3’29». Первый вариант также называют «десятичные градусы».

Упрощенно перевод такой:
69.05815 -> 69°
0.05815*60 = 3.489 -> 3′
0.489*60 = 29.34 -> 29″

И обратно:
29/60/60 = 0.00806
3/60 = 0.05
69 + 0.05 + 0.00806 = 69.05806

На сколько помню, в Garmin можно было настроить формат чисел.

Читайте также:
1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(Пока оценок нет)
Загрузка...
Adblock
detector